Goal

This article describes how to ensure that external calls from Eloqua are updating records correctly in the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system by testing the call with a single contact.

Contact information is sent to your CRM through external calls that are linked to internal events and placed in your CRM program. When a contact enters a program, the contact flows down a specific path based on the decision rules you have set up. Because testing this process would be long if an external call was actually sending the information, Eloqua gives you the ability to test an external call directly from the Setup area.
